1102. Deputy Paul Murphy asked the Minister for Social Protection the policy under which the payment of child benefit claims for 16 and 17 year olds is only issued for July and August if the child returns to school in September 2022; the system that is in place to inform child benefit recipients that they will not receive their payment in July; the rationale behind this system; and if her Department considered that parents will have to purchase schoolbooks and uniforms in August 2022 without the help of the child benefit payment. [29443/22]
